What You Will Learn
This live webinar provides an in-depth look at how Vulcan Grade Control STM supports efficiency, accuracy, and speed across daily operations, presented by experienced industry professionals.
Consolidate All Your Data Pull from multiple data sources and perform on-the-fly reconciliation between them. Grade Control’s reporting options provide easy visual and qualitative comparisons, giving your team a clear, consolidated picture of what the data is telling you.
Stay Ahead of Variance Learn how to proactively adjust tonnage and grade profiles for mine plans using custom grade and criteria cutoffs and material calculations tailored to your operation, rather than responding after the fact.
Model at the Scale You Need Work across multiple headings or benches simultaneously, from single-block resolution at blast level through to full bench scale. The same sophisticated metallurgical and estimation automation applied to daily mining can now be used weeks to months in advance.
Accelerate Scheduling and Routing More efficient short-term scheduling and routing supports faster, better-informed decisions at every stage of the planning cycle.
Automate with Python Apply the full capability of Python scripting to reduce manual effort, streamline workflows, and generate accurate short-term models with the speed required to inform daily decisions.
